About 1-[8-fluoro-6-[(1R)-1-fluoroethyl]-4-methyl-3-(3-methyl-1,2,4-oxadiazol-5-yl)quinolin-2-yl]-N-(oxan-4-yl)piperidin-4-amine

1-[8-fluoro-6-[(1R)-1-fluoroethyl]-4-methyl-3-(3-methyl-1,2,4-oxadiazol-5-yl)quinolin-2-yl]-N-(oxan-4-yl)piperidin-4-amine (PubChem CID 137434244) has the molecular formula C25H31F2N5O2 and a molecular weight of 471.55 g/mol. Its IUPAC name is 1-[8-fluoro-6-[(1R)-1-fluoroethyl]-4-methyl-3-(3-methyl-1,2,4-oxadiazol-5-yl)quinolin-2-yl]-N-(oxan-4-yl)piperidin-4-amine.
